Small town excitment

 


A few weeks ago a high speed chase ended up with the suspect holed up in a motel room (a second one behind the sign in the middle of the scene. All those cars in the middle of the street were Sheriff's and Police with blue lights flashing. US highway 70 was blocked from my street (Blue Ridge Rd) to Craigmont, where the CVS is located. That's where I was standing to take this photo. I'm glad someone had posted about the situation to Facebook, so I took the detour.

I did have an appointment at CVS to get my COVID shot, so went around the back way, where all the traffic was being shuttled. The roadblock lasted for hours, and eventually the police entered the room to find that the suspect had killed himself. He apparently had warrants out for some sexual abuse of minors. Nobody said what they were when the police issued a report later that day. 

Since I already was going home by way of a detour (different than the backroad, Craigmont zoo!) I stopped at a local watering hole...which also has good food! Do people still say watering hole for a bar?

Considering it was 5:00 on a grey cool day, they were mobbed. So I sat myself at the bar, rather than waiting for a table. Nobody had been answering the phone for me to get a take-out.


I ha a Dr. Pepper and Fish and Chips, while all those folks were waiting for tables...I swear I was done before some of them got a table. And I had to send the fish back since the first serving had been over cooked...just dark brown. (I always think a 5:00 meal means getting what was cooked for lunch and just waiting around all afternoon!) Anyway the second serving was huge and good, and fried onion rings, lots of good ole fat there!
